2- Psychological Tactics

Beyond the mere placement of Xs and Os, Tic Tac Toe is a psychological battle. A key trick is to lead your opponent into making a move that sets you up for victory. Start by placing your initial mark in the corner – this will often force your opponent to the center. Subsequently, aim to build a fork, a situation where you have two opportunities to win, forcing your opponent into a defensive stance.

  • Control the Center: The center square is the most strategically important position in Tic Tac Toe. Starting in the center gives you the best chance of controlling the game. If your opponent starts in the center, try to block them from creating a winning line.
  • Create Threats: Always aim to create opportunities for yourself where you have two in a row and can win on your next move. This forces your opponent to play defensively and gives you more control over the game.
  • Blocking Opponent’s Threats: Pay close attention to your opponent’s moves. If they have two in a row, make sure to block that line on your next move to prevent them from winning.
  • Build Forks: A fork is a move that creates two opportunities for you to win on your next turn. This puts your opponent in a difficult situation where they can only block one of your potential wins.
  • Defense and Offense: Strive to balance defense and offense. While blocking your opponent’s threats, always look for ways to create your winning opportunities.
  • Corner Strategy: Corners are generally less critical than the center but can be useful. If you start in the corner, your opponent will likely take the center, so be prepared to counter their strategy.
  • Edge Strategy: Starting on an edge can be challenging as it gives your opponent the chance to control the center. Focus on blocking their center control and creating diagonal threats.
  • Pay Attention to Patterns: Recognize common patterns that lead to wins. These include three in a row (horizontal, vertical, or diagonal) and potential forks.
  • Mind Psychological Tactics: Sometimes, making unexpected moves can throw off your opponent’s strategy. They might focus on blocking perceived threats rather than their strategy.
  • Plan Ahead: Think a few moves ahead. Anticipate your opponent’s moves and have a plan to counter their strategies.
  • Endgame Strategy: As the game progresses and the board fills up, your options will become limited. Focus on blocking your opponent while also looking for your winning moves.
